Hey all! Update time.
The BRZ has turned into my weekend car and just hit 23k miles. Two weeks ago, I was driving and doing errands in the BRZ and it threw a check engine light (P0016). I used my scan tool and found P0016 is Crank/Cam Position Correlation – Bank 1 Sensor “A” Long story short, I took the BRZ to the Subaru dealership in the city of Ontario for diagnosis. They had the vehicle for 7 days, verified the code, replaced the Cam sprocket, changed out several o-rings, changed the coolant, and an oil change. All the work was covered under warranty. I found the cam sprocket, 13320AA070, which Subaru replaced, costs about $270 new from Subaru. As I was driving away from the dealership, the check engine light came back. Per the service advisor, they are now going to replace the ECU under warranty. Apparently the P0016 code forces the sprocket to change certain values in the ECU and makes it impossible to reset the 'values' back to the original state. (Can someone with more knowledge on this explain this better?) So yeah, I'm kind of discouraged with my BRZ right now. The car is treated like a Queen with regular oil changes and it is giving me issues with only 23k miles on it. Does anyone else have similar issues and gotten the car successfully repaired? I've read in past forum threads that some BRZ/86 with P0016 code have been plagued with continuous issues and eventually lemon'd. I hope this isnt the case with my BRZ. Anyways that's it for the updates. |
